WebIn the module entitled Overview of Analytic Studies it was noted that Rothman describes the case-control strategy as follows: "Case-control degree will top tacit via considers as the starting point a source population, which representing a hypothetical study population in which a cohort study might have were conducted.The source population is that … WebA nested case–control (NCC) study is a variation of a case–control study in which cases and controls are drawn from the population in a fully enumerated cohort. [1] Usually, the exposure of interest is only measured among the cases and the selected controls. Thus the nested case–control study is more efficient than the full cohort design.

WebA population-based case-control study is one in which the cases come from a precisely defined population, such as a fixed geographic area, and the controls are sampled directly from the same population.
